The total number of COVID-19 recoveries have risen to 11,902 after another 121 people recovers from the illness in the Maldives.
Health Protection Agency (HPA) said that from 6 p.m. yesterday to 6 p.m. today, 121 people recovered from COVID-19, totaling the number of recoveries in the country 11,902 with another 1,039 people still in treatment.
In the same time frame, 47 people have tested positive including 46 in Male' area and 01 in operational resorts.
So far, there have been 46 COVID-related fatalities in the Maldives that includes 39 locals, seven Bangladeshi nationals and a man from Philippines.
